For a moist, yummy pancake try these. And the Strawberry Syrup is so good.
1 ½ cup milk
Heat in small saucepan.
1 cup quick oats
Stir into milk, remove from heat and let stand 5 minutes.
1 cup flour
3 Tbls brown sugar
2 tsp baking powder
¼ tsp salt
¼ to ½ tsp cinnamon
Stir together in a bowl and make a well in center.
3 eggs
3 tsp oil
½ tsp vanilla
Add to dry ingredients and add oatmeal/milk. Stir together.
Strawberry Syrup
1 cup orange juice
2 tsp cornstarch
Heat in a saucepan over medium heat until thick and bubbly.
2 cups sliced strawberries
Add to saucepan and cook 2 minutes.
